Italian Amaretti Recipe (Easy Almond Cookies)

Ingredients

300 g (10,6 oz) Ground Almonds (almond meal)

300 g (10,6 oz) Granulated Sugar

Pinch of Fine Sea Salt

4-5 (135 g / 4.7oz) Free-Range Egg Whites, at room temperature

1 tbsp (14 g) Amaretto liqueur, optional (or a few drops of almond extract)

Whole Raw Almonds, optional, for decoration

Powdered Sugar, for dusting


Instructions

1. Preheat the oven 

  • Preheat the oven to 170°C (340°F).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.

2. Make the Cookie Dough

  • Combine Dry Ingredients - In a large mixing bowl, combine the ground almonds, granulated sugar, and a pinch of fine sea salt. Set aside.

  • Whip the Egg Whites - Using an electric hand mixer, whisk the egg whites until stiff peaks form. The peaks should stand upright without collapsing.

  •  (Ensure your mixing bowl and whisk are completely grease-free, as even a trace of grease can prevent the egg whites from whipping properly.)

Chef’s Tip: Egg Whites: For best results, bring egg whites to room temperature before whipping, as this improves volume and stability.

  • Combine Wet and Dry Ingredients - Add a spoonful of the whipped egg whites to the almond mixture and mix until almost combined. Using a metal spoon or rubber spatula, carefully fold in the remaining egg whites in two batches. Fold just until the ingredients are combined.

  • Add Amaretto (optional): Gently mix in the Amaretto liqueur, if using, for an extra almond flavor boost.

4. Shape the Cookies

  • Scoop and roll: Use a small cookie scoop or tablespoon measuring spoon to portion out heaped tablespoons of the dough. Roll each portion gently into a ball between your palms.

  • Place on the baking sheet: Arrange the dough balls on the prepared baking sheet, leaving about 3 cm (1½ inches) between each cookie.

  • Decorate (optional): Lightly press a whole almond into the top of each cookie, if desired.

5. Bake

  • Place the baking sheet in the preheated oven and bake for 15-20 minutes, or until the cookies develop a light golden-brown crust.

Chef’s Tip: For a crispier cookie, bake for an additional 2-3 minutes, watching carefully to avoid over-browning.

6. Cool and Dust

  • Cool on the cookie sheet: Remove the cookies from the oven and let the cookies cool on the baking sheet for 10 minutes to firm up.

  • Transfer to a wire rack: Carefully slide the parchment paper with the cookies onto a wire rack and let them cool completely.

  • Dust with powdered sugar: Using a fine sieve, generously dust the cooled cookies with powdered sugar before serving.

Notes

Storage Instructions

Room Temperature: Store the Amaretti cookies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to one week.

Freezing: For longer storage, place the cookies in an airtight container and freeze for up to three months.

Serving After Freezing: Allow frozen cookies to come to room temperature before serving to enjoy their chewy texture.
